Casio Exilim EX-Z33 Digital Camera

Casio-Exilim-EX-Z33Casio have announced another digital point and shoot camera in the Exilim range named the EX-Z33. This camera has a 10.1 megapixel sensor, 3x optical zoom and a 2.5 inch widescreen LCD display.

Automatic face detection is included on this camera as well as an auto shutter mode that can detect blur and adjust the settings accordingly. [Read more…]

Adesso SlimTouch Wireless Keyboard

Adesso_WKB-4000UB-1If you are looking for a new wireless keyboard for your computer and need one with a touchpad built in then Adesso have created the SlimTouch which features what you need. It is called the WKB-4000UV and uses the 2.4GHz RF band to allow it to function up to 30 feet away from the receiver.

The keyboard has 87 low-profile keys that use a scissor style mechanism. Each key has a life cycle of 6 million clicks that should see you through a good few years of usage and more. [Read more…]

NVIDIA Ion IdeaPad S12 Waiting for Windows 7 Launch

Lenovo-Idea-Pad-S12A few months back, Lenova announced the IdeaPad S12 netbook that was going to run the NVIDIA Ion chip set. We now hear that they have delayed shipping of the unit as they are waiting for Windows 7 to be launched. As Windows 7 is literally around the corner the good news is that the netbook/laptop should be shipping by the end of this month.

The IdeaPad S12 runs an Intel Atom N270 processor and uses the NVIDIA GeForce 9400 graphics chip. This particular model with these specs will cost more than a standard version running just the Intel Atom processor. [Read more…]
